A new leader for Camden Elementary - maybe
By Debbie Lowe

Williams
Afarewell reception is planned for Camden E l eme n t a r y P r i n c i p a D e b b y Williams Oct. 23 from 2 to 5 p.m. in the Camden school gymnasium.

The flyer received by the Comet read, "This is an opportunity to thank Mrs.Williams for all that she has done for Camden Elementary School and wish her well in her new position with the Department of Education."

When contacted for an interview, Williams refused to discuss the matter. Her e-mail reply to the request said, "I have not officially resigned yet, so I don't feel comfortable talking about it."

Delphi Community School Corporation Superintendent Ralph Walker confirmed Tuesday that no letter of resignation has been received from Williams.

"She's going to leave," he said. "She's announced it to the staff."

Walker said his understanding of the matter is Williams has not been offered the job with the State Department of Education in writing. She refuses to formally notify DCSC of her impending resignation without confirmation of the new position.

Walker said he was told that Williams' last day is Oct. 25.

DCSC board of school trustees scheduled an executive session Oct. 12 at 6 p.m. "to receive information about, and interview, prospective employees."

The next school board meeting is Oct. 23 at 7 p.m.
